Maysville – Ralph D. Gelter, 68, of US 62 in Maysville, passed away Tuesday, January 31, 2006 at the VA Medical Center in Lexington.

Mr. Gelter was born in Cherry Fork on March 26, 1937, to the late Lorin and Grace Rickey Gelter. He was retired from the Dayton Power and Light Company where he had worked as a control room operator at the J.M. Stuart Station. He had also worked 25 years as a Mason County Deputy Jailer and had been a Maysville Police Officer. His love for gardening kept him busy in his spare time.

Survivors include a son, Todd Gelter, and a daughter, Kellie Gelter, both of Maysville; two brothers Frank (Patsy) Gelter of Winchester, Ohio and Charles Gelter of Russellville; six sisters, Alice Dailey, of Ripley, Vivian (Jim) Farley of Mt. Orab, and Dorothy Manlief of Moores Hill, Indiana, Sadie (Nelson) Allen of Chillicothe, and Norvilla Wright and Minnie Foster, both of Seaman. One brother, Howard Gelter preceded him in death.

Services for Ralph Gelter will be held Friday, February 3, 2006 at 1:00 p.m. at Brell & Son Funeral Home with Rev Harry Brooks officiating.

Burial will follow in the Maysville Cemetery. Pallbearers will be Jim Farley, John Mattingly, Donnie Young, Larry Boone, Stanley Gulley, and Roger Smith.

Visitation will be Thursday from 5 to 8 p.m.
